Key Features to Look For

You need shoes that help your feet. Here are some important features:

  • Good Arch Support: Look for shoes with strong arch support. This helps your feet and ankles. It can also improve blood flow.
  • Wide Toe Box: Your toes need space! A wide toe box allows your toes to move. This can stop them from getting cramped. This is good for circulation.
  • Cushioning: Shoes with good cushioning are comfy. They also help absorb shock. This makes walking easier on your feet.
  • Adjustable Features: Look for shoes with laces or straps. These let you adjust the fit. This is important for comfort and support.
  • Breathable Material: Your feet can get sweaty. Breathable materials like mesh let air in. This keeps your feet cool and dry.

Important Materials

The material of your shoes matters. Here are some good choices:

  • Leather: Leather is durable and often water-resistant. It can also mold to your feet over time.
  • Mesh: Mesh is lightweight and breathable. It is good for warmer weather.
  • Synthetic Materials: Many shoes use synthetic materials. They are often strong and affordable. They can be a good choice for your budget.
  • Rubber Soles: Rubber soles give you good grip. This helps you walk safely on different surfaces.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What is poor circulation?

A: Poor circulation means blood doesn’t flow well to your feet and legs. This can cause pain, numbness, and swelling.

Q: How can walking shoes help with poor circulation?

A: Good walking shoes support your feet. They also improve blood flow. This can reduce pain and discomfort.

Q: What is a wide toe box?

A: A wide toe box gives your toes space to move. This helps improve circulation and comfort.
